West Midlands Sugar Factory set for closure6.02.56pm BST (GMT +0100) Tue 4th Jul 2006 Liberal Democrat MEP for the West Midlands, Liz Lynne today called on British Sugar to reconsider its decision to close a sugar beet factory in Allscott, Shropshire that is set for closure with the potential loss of over 100 jobs. Commenting on the announced closure, Liz Lynne, who is the Lib Dem employment spokesperson in the European Parliament said: "The British Sugar announcement will not only be a devastating blow to the local workforce but it will also adversely affect beet farmers across the West Midlands region." "The timing of the decision is rather bizarre considering the fact that sugar beet is currently the most profitable of the mainstream arable products, according to the NFU." "If British Sugar are intent on closing this plant then they must ensure that workers get a fair deal when it comes to compensation. This decision will adversely affect hundreds of lives."
